Depeche Mode‘s “Where’s The Revolution” has been given the remix treatment.

The British electronic band’s track “Where’s The Revolution” is the first single from forthcoming their full-length, Spirit (which will be available to purchase from March 17), an album produced by Simian Mobile Disco with contributions from Matrixxman.

Subsequent to the LP’s release, a nine-track EP of “Where’s The Revolution” remixes will follow. Simian Mobile Disco contribute, while Pearson Sound offers two versions of the track, as well as remixes from Terence Fixmer, Ewan Pearson and Patrice Bäumel.

Where’s The Revolution Remixes will be released as a double vinyl pack on April 18.
